Fleming House Charity Assembly

Fleming House came together for their charity assembly on 27 Feb, 2019. The House is supporting Hong Kong Children’s Cancer Foundation and HUSK Cambodia this year.

In October students raised money by completing a sponsored silence and run, holding a bake sale, a dress red day and soaking the teacher. Their efforts raised HK$50,000.

At the assembly, representatives from the charities explained to students their work. Karen and Sia from 12F handed a cheque for $25,170 to the Development Director of HK Children’s Cancer Foundation, Lucille Wong.

The Year 11F students talked about their volunteer work in Cambodia during Quest Week 2018, working with the charity Husk Cambodia. They saw how the $25,000 that, Fleming House had previously donated, was being used to build homes and schools, supporting the local community who are trying to earn their way out of poverty by working in and around the local tourist business.

Senior Head of House Mr Phil Tudor said, “Whilst the subject matter was sobering, we all left the assembly proud to see the benefits of all our fundraising efforts.”
